Enhancing Visual Hierarchy and Brand Identity

One of the key strengths of Elegant Watercolor Backgrounds is their ability to support visual hierarchy. Because they are soft and not overly busy, they act as a backdrop rather than a distraction. This makes it easier to layer headlines, icons, and call-to-action buttons without losing clarity.

For websites that rely heavily on content marketing, these assets can unify disparate graphics under a consistent brand identity. Think of using them across article thumbnails, category pages, and social media previews to reinforce a cohesive visual language. The result is stronger category recognition and a more professional-looking content page that readers can navigate with ease.

Design That Drives Clicks

Visuals play a huge role in click-through potential. On platforms like Pinterest or Instagram, users scroll fast and decide quickly. Elegant Watercolor Backgrounds offer a middle ground — they’re decorative enough to stop the scroll but clean enough to keep the message clear.

This makes them particularly effective for:

  1. Creating social media graphics that stand out in crowded feeds,
  2. Improving eBook covers or digital guide visuals by adding texture and interest,
  3. Enhancing digital download packaging to make resources feel premium and trustworthy.
